An established large nursing home is seeking an experienced Registered Manager to lead the service through its next phase of development.
Recently acquired by a committed provider, the home is in a positive position with approximately 88% occupancy, established digital care systems and a clear opportunity for a commercially aware, quality-focused leader to build on existing foundations.
You will take overall responsibility for the operational, clinical and regulatory performance of the home. This includes leading the staff team, maintaining high standards of person-centred care, ensuring CQC compliance, managing occupancy and developing positive relationships with residents, families, professionals and the local community.
You will have previous Registered Manager experience within a residential or nursing care setting.
A nursing qualification and active NMC PIN are highly desirable.
You will have a strong understanding of CQC requirements, safeguarding, clinical governance and care home operations.
You will be commercially aware, organised and confident managing a large staff team.
You will be committed to delivering safe, dignified and high-quality care for older people.
You will be able to balance operational demands with a visible, supportive leadership style.
